I get this question all the time. “I went to school to be a wildlife biologist but I don’t want to work for the state, is there another option?” Zack Vucurevich is showing us exactly how to go about that with his Whetstone Habitat Consulting.
Wildlife management is one of the coolest jobs you can have as a wildlife nerd the problem is that if you go work for an agency you are more often stuck behind the desk and not doing the thing you actual love.
Zack is setting out to chart his own path and hoping that he can make a living consulting for some of the top hunting properties in the country. In this podcast we talk about the path he is on and some of the struggles. We also nerd out on whitetail management a bit and talk about the product he offers.
